It’s a little out of focus, and there are no prices, but the above picture is our first glimpse at the full GT Fish & Oyster menu. Kevin Boehm tweeted this picture a few hours ago, and we’ve been scrambling to decipher it. Of course, we knew that there would be a lobster roll and also clam chowder, but, to be sure, this menu proves that it won’t be some kind of basic seafood shack. While you will be able to find fish and chips, the bulk of the menu is filled with Mediterranean-inspired dishes, which makes total sense considering chef Giuseppe Tentori’s previous restaurant and his roots. Items includes a foie gras terrine, shrimp brushcetta, braised octopus, and a crab agnolotti. We’re hoping an even more official menu will be coming along shortly, but for now take a look at what we were able to make out from the picture.
